Kei Nishikori: Japanese tennis player
Kei Nishikori is a Japanese professional tennis player. He is the second male Japanese player to have been ranked in the top 5 in singles, and the only one to do so in the Open Era. Nishikori first reached his career-high singles ranking of world No. 4 in March 2015. He is currently ranked world No. 54 by the Association of Tennis Professionals (ATP).
